In this dissertation, the organic molecular self-assembly and the photoinduced reaction was studied by scanning tunneling microscopy (STM). Two self-assembled basic molecular devices, molecular switches and molecular conductive wires were constructed on HOPG surface.1.A series of 1, 3, 5-triazine incorporating benzenazonaphthanlene moieties has been synthesized. The ordered self-assembly of compound 4 was observed by STM. Photoinduced isomerization causes the self-assembly disordered. The ordered self-assembly of compound 3 was also obtained. The coexistence of trans- and cis- isomer was observed after photo irradiation. The results presented prove the possibility of using them as molecular switches.2.The self-assembly and photopolymerization of compounds containing diacetylene group were studied on HOPG surface. The self-assembled conjugated polydiacetylene conductive nanowires were obtained after applying UV irradiation. The spacing between nanowires can be controlled by co-adsorption. The results provide a general method to obtain well-ordered and spacing-controllable conductive nanowires.3.Other liquid crystal molecules and dendrimer were synthesized. The self-assembly of them was studied on HOPG.
